+Tue Apr 14 20:27:58 UTC 2015 - [email protected]
+
+- updated to 1.20140408
+ see /usr/share/doc/packages/perl-Test-MockObject/Changes
+
+ 1.20140408 2014-04-07 17:38:44-07:00 America/Los_Angeles
+ - enabled Travis CI (no user-visible changes)
+ - improved fields-based object support (Olivier Mengué, Maxime Soulé)
+
+ 1.20140328 2014-03-28 16:17:59-07:00 America/Los_Angeles
+ - support added for fields-based objects (Gavin Mogan, RT #84535)
+
